All Risk Protection Orders must be completed and filed by the Behavioral Services Division.

Explanation:
RPO processing is centralized in the Behavioral Services Division, meaning all Risk Protection Orders are completed and filed through that division. This arrangement ensures consistency in how orders are prepared, documented, and submitted to the court, which helps guarantee the orders are enforceable and properly tracked across the agency. The division handles the intake, risk assessment, completion of the required paperwork, and the filing with the court, coordinating with other units as needed to support service and enforcement. Because the policy sets this responsibility squarely with the Behavioral Services Division, the statement is true.
